Detailsinfo

A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, has been found in Fastify up to 3.29.3/4.10.1. Affected by this issue is an unknown function of the component Content-Type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ross-site request forgery v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-352. The web application does not, or can not, sufficiently verify whether a well-formed, valid, consistent request was intentionally provided by the user who submitted the request. Impacted is integrity. CVE summarizes:

Fastify is a web framework with minimal overhead and plugin architecture. The attacker can use the incorrect `Content-Type` to bypass the `Pre-Flight` checking of `fetch`. `fetch()` requests with Content-Type’s essence as "application/x-www-form-urlencoded", "multipart/form-data", or "text/plain", could potentially be used to invoke routes that only accepts `application/json` content type, thus bypassing any CORS protection, and therefore they could lead to a Cross-Site Request Forgery attack. This issue has been patched in version 4.10.2 and 3.29.4. As a workaround, implement Cross-Site Request Forgery protection using `@fastify/csrf'.

The weakness was released 11/23/2022 as GHSA-3fjj-p79j-c9hh. The advisory is shared for download at github.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2022-41919 since 09/30/2022. Successful exploitation requires user interaction by the victim.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available.

Upgrading to version 3.29.4 or 4.10.2 eliminates this vulnerability. Applying the patch 62dde76f1f7aca76e38625fe8d983761f26e6fc9 is able to eliminate this problem. The bugfix is ready for download at github.com. The best possible mitigation is suggested to be upgrading to the latest version.
